Course Description

Headaches and migraines are complex conditions with a variety of causes. It is interesting to distinguish between the different types of headaches and migraines, analyze their individual characteristics, and understand their underlying causes.

A thorough understanding of these conditions is essential to providing effective treatment and relief, and it allows us to better navigate strategies for optimizing treatment once we understand the underlying cause.

loading="lazy"

THIS IS WHAT WE'LL COVER IN THE WEBINAR

  • Migraine with and without aura
  • Horton's Headache
  • Trigeminal Neuralgia
  • Menstrual Migraine
  • Tension headache
  • Cluster headache
  • MOH – Medication-induced headache
  • Secondary headaches; related to head injuries, surgery on the skull and brain, vascular diseases, medication use, poisoning, and various diseases.
